Understanding Breast Augmentation in New York City

Breast augmentation, also known as a boob job or breast enlargement, is a surgical procedure aimed at increasing breast size, enhancing shape, or improving symmetry. In New York City, this procedure is carried out by board - certified plastic surgeons in accredited medical facilities, ensuring both safety and quality. The Recovery Process

What to Expect Immediately After Surgery

After breast augmentation surgery, patients will recover in a state - of - the - art recovery suite while being monitored by a nurse until they feel well enough to be discharged. A specialized, long - lasting local anesthesia is used to dramatically decrease any discomfort. The surgery is usually an outpatient procedure, meaning patients can return home the same day.

When performed with “twilight” sedation, patients should arrange for an escort to bring them home as they will not be able to drive for 24 hours after the administration of anesthesia. Upon leaving the facility, patients will be provided with thorough discharge instructions to guide them through the initial postoperative period.

Early Recovery Phase

In the first 24 - 48 hours, patients may experience a small amount of swelling, bruising, and discomfort. Many patients need to take pain medicine during this time period. Most patients spend the first 1 - 2 days resting, reading, watching TV, and going for short walks. After 48 hours, patients will be able to shower normally.

If a patient has a desk job that does not require strenuous activity, they will likely be able to return to work by the 3rd or 4th day after surgery. At this point, most women switch to only taking Tylenol for pain. However, if a patient wants to give themselves a bit of extra pampering, it is recommended to take a week off.

Mid - Recovery Phase

By one month after surgery, the vast majority of patients say they feel "back to normal." Bruising, discomfort, and most swelling has disappeared. The breasts will still continue to "settle" into their final position over the course of the next few months, and a tiny bit of additional swelling will go away.

Patients should still follow all post - operative instructions carefully and refrain from activities that could put stress on their incisions. They will typically return to the office for their first follow - up appointment a day after the procedure so that the surgeon can evaluate how they are healing.

Full Recovery

By 6 - 8 weeks, patients will usually be cleared to do all types of physical activity again, with some exceptions for elite athletes who put extremely high demands on their chest muscles. The swelling in the breasts will take several months to fully dissipate, with the final result typically being visible around 6 months.

Scars will be firm and pink for at least six weeks. Then, they may remain about the same size for several months or may appear to widen. With time, the scars will begin to fade, although they will never disappear completely.

Type of Implants

There are two main types of breast implants: saline and silicone. Silicone gel implants more closely mimic the texture and feel of natural breast tissue, but they may require a slightly longer incision for placement. Saline implants are filled with sterile saltwater solution and can be inserted through a slightly shorter incision. The type of implant chosen can affect the recovery process. For example, silicone implants may take a bit longer to settle into place, while saline implants may cause less swelling initially.

Implant Placement

Implants can be placed either behind the breast tissue (subglandular placement) or behind the pectoral (chest) muscle (submuscular placement). Placing the implants behind the chest muscle may reduce the risk of capsular contracture but can add a few days longer for recovery compared to subglandular placement. Women with very little natural breast tissue may achieve a more natural - looking result with the implant placed behind the chest muscle, but they may also experience more discomfort during the recovery period.

Patient's Overall Health

A patient's general health status significantly impacts the recovery process. Individuals who are in good overall health, with no underlying medical conditions such as diabetes or heart disease, tend to recover more quickly. They have a stronger immune system to fight off any potential infections and better overall physical resilience. Additionally, patients who maintain a healthy lifestyle, including a balanced diet and regular exercise (before the surgery), are more likely to have a smoother recovery.

Preparing for Breast Augmentation and Recovery

Consultation with the Surgeon

During the initial consultation, the surgeon will perform a comprehensive evaluation of the patient's general health and medical history, as well as assess the current condition of the breasts. The patient and the surgeon will create a surgical plan to best achieve the desired outcome. The patient should have an open and honest conversation with the surgeon about their expectations, and the surgeon will guide them through selecting the proper implant type, incision type, implant placement, and size.

The surgeon will also talk through the risks with the patient and provide information on the manufacturer's insert that comes with the selected implants. Patients should inform the surgeon if they smoke or if they're taking any medications, vitamins, or drugs and ask any questions about the surgery, recovery, and expected outcome.

Pre - operative Preparations

Patients will be provided with instructions to thoroughly prepare them for surgery, including guidelines on eating and drinking, smoking, and taking or avoiding vitamins, iron tablets, and specific medications. They may be given prescriptions that should be filled prior to the day of surgery. Depending on the medical history, patients may be asked to provide pre - operative clearance from another doctor.

As the procedure is usually performed under “twilight” sedation, patients should arrange for someone to drive them home after the surgery and ensure they have someone to assist them for the first few days. Practical preparations like organizing for someone to be with them on the day of the surgery, scheduling sufficient time off work for recovery, and establishing a comfortable space at home for recuperation are also essential.

Post - operative Care

Post - operative care is critical for the success of a breast augmentation. The initial recovery phase usually includes prescribed medications to alleviate pain and avert infection. Patients will be required to wear a compression garment to help reduce swelling and support the breasts. They should also maintain a healthy lifestyle, including a balanced diet and adequate rest, to promote healing.

Patients should avoid vigorous activities for a minimum of six weeks post - procedure and follow all the surgeon's instructions regarding breast massages, which can help the implants settle well. They should also attend all follow - up appointments with the surgeon to ensure proper healing and to address any concerns or complications that may arise.

Cost of Breast Augmentation and Recovery - Related Expenses

Factors Affecting the Cost

The cost of breast augmentation in New York City depends on several factors. The type of procedure used, such as whether it's a simple augmentation or a more complex procedure with additional elements, can significantly impact the cost. The type of implants also plays a role. Saline implants are generally less costly than silicone implants, but 85% of patients opt for the more expensive silicone implants due to their more natural feel.

The surgeon's fee is another major factor. Surgeons with more experience and a better reputation may charge higher fees. Operating room and anesthesia fees are also included in the total cost. Additionally, the consultation fee, which often rolls into the procedure itself, can vary depending on the surgeon and the practice.

Recovery - Related Expenses

Recovery - related expenses may include the cost of prescribed medications for pain management and infection prevention. Compression garments, which are often recommended for a certain period after surgery, also add to the cost. Follow - up appointments with the surgeon are essential for monitoring the recovery process and ensuring proper healing, and these appointments may also incur costs.

Risks and Complications

As with any surgical intervention, breast augmentation comes with its own set of risks and potential complications:

  • Capsular Contracture: This is the most common complication after breast augmentation. It occurs when the scar tissue around the implant tightens, causing hardening or discomfort. The breast may appear misshapen, and in severe cases, surgery may be required to remove the implant and scar tissue and, if desired, place new implants.
  • Bleeding: There is a risk of bleeding during or after the surgery. This can usually be managed, but in some cases, additional treatment may be necessary.
  • Infection: Infection typically presents within a week after surgery and can usually be treated by antibiotics and, in some cases, removing the implant. Maintaining proper hygiene and following the surgeon's post - operative instructions can help reduce the risk of infection.
  • Numbness: Some patients may experience numbness or changes in sensation in the breasts or nipples. This can be temporary or permanent, depending on the extent of nerve damage during the surgery.
  • Implant Rupture: Implants can rupture as a result of injury or from normal compression and movement of the breast causing friction with the manmade shell of the implant. If a saline implant ruptures, the salt - water is harmlessly absorbed by the body, resulting in the breast appearing deflated. With both saline and silicone implant ruptures, a revision surgery is usually performed to replace the implant and remove any troublesome scar tissue.
